A Hamilton woman was attacked by a dog Wednesday, and she is hoping the owner comes forward because she believes the dog is still on the loose. Stacy Martin was lucky-doctors at Fort Hamilton hospital say the animal just missed an artery in her left leg during the attack yesterday afternoon.
Martin went to visit a friend on North Eleventh Street. She got out of her car and turned to lock the door when she was attacked by the dog. The dog bit her ankle and went for her face. Martin pushed the dog away and that's when the dog sank its teeth into her thigh. A friend helped Martin escape the dog.
The animal was last seen running down North Hamilton. Martin says she didn't get a good look at the animal but she thinks it is a black lab with a red collar.
